Starting Point and Meeting Logistics
The tour begins at Kayak Beach, Willow Beach, AZ, a spot that’s accessible for most travelers with transportation arranged. The activity ends back at the same location, simplifying logistics. Since private transportation isn’t included, you’ll want to plan how to get there, but the meeting point is straightforward and close to popular areas.
What the Tour Offers
For $249 per group (up to four people), you get a giant SUP, paddles, lifejackets, and guidance from certified SUP guides. That’s quite a package, especially considering that all the gear and instruction are included, which is a big plus for beginners or those unfamiliar with paddleboarding. The tour lasts about 4 hours, covering roughly 4 miles round-trip — a comfortable distance for most, with plenty of opportunities to stop and enjoy the scenery.
Itinerary Breakdown
The journey kicks off on the Colorado River, where your guides lead you through Black Canyon’s stunning landscape. The highlights are visits to Emerald Cave and Echo Cave, along with other hidden coves along the canyon’s edge.
Stop 1: Colorado River
You’ll paddle along the calm waters, soaking in the rugged beauty of the canyon walls. The guide will point out notable features and explain the history or geology if you’re curious. The calm, protected waters make it easy for beginners and give you a chance to get comfortable on the board.
Stops for Swimming and Exploring
Throughout the tour, there are scheduled stops—not just to catch your breath but to swim in the clear waters, explore secret coves, or just relax on your paddleboard. The stops are a key part of the fun, allowing you to soak in the scenery and enjoy moments of leisure.
Emerald Cave
The highlight for many is reaching the Emerald Cave, famous for its glowing green waters. The guide will likely give some background on its formation and the best way to experience its beauty.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for beginners?
Yes, the tour is designed to be beginner-friendly with expert guides providing instruction, and the giant SUP is very stable, making it easier for newcomers to paddle comfortably.
What’s included in the price?
You get all gear (giant SUP, paddles, lifejackets), bottled water, expert guides, and the park fee when booked with transportation. Snacks are also included, so you won’t need to bring much.
Can I go on this tour if I don’t have my own gear or experience?
Absolutely. All necessary gear and instruction are included, making this accessible even for first-timers. It’s a relaxed, social outing rather than an intense workout.
How long is the tour?
The entire experience lasts about 4 hours, covering around 4 miles, with plenty of stops for swimming and exploring.
Do I need to bring anything?
Since snacks and water are provided, just bring sun protection, comfortable clothing, and perhaps a towel. Private transportation isn’t included, so plan accordingly.
What if I want to cancel?
You can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ours in advance. Cancellations less than 24 hours before the tour start are non-refundable, so plan ahead.
